1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
let rect = display.rect(100, 100, 400, 400)
rect.color = color.clear
times(100, () => {
let r = display.star(random.num(-200, 200), random.num(-200, 200), random.num(5, 15))
r.color = color.hsb(170, 75, 95)
rect.add(r)
})
update(() => {
display.each("star", (el) => el.rotate(1))
rect.pointTo(input)
rect.move(2)
})
let rect = display.rect(100, 100, 400, 400)
rect.color = color.clear
times(100, () => {
let r = display.star(random.num(-200, 200), random.num(-200, 200), random.num(5, 15))
r.color = color.hsb(170, 75, 95)
rect.add(r)
})
update(() => {
display.each("star", (el) => el.rotate(1))
rect.pointTo(input)
rect.move(2)
})